What are the different grades of strains and what are the differences between them?
Grade 1: little to no tearing of the muscle
-recovery a few days to a week, PRICE
Grade 2: more tearing than grade 1, more severe
- recovery 2-4 weeks, may need DR. referral and physical therapy
Grade 3: complete rupture of muscle, need to go to the doctor
- can take several months to heal
